Several years ago when our children were young and money was tight I brought our Chevy Venture van in for some work.  The van had several issues ranging from a water pump to a Body Control Module (BCM).  The work was going to total over $1,000 which was really going to hurt at that time.  After the work was completed the mechanic had good news to report.  The BCM sometimes needs to be programed which incurs a $250 programing fee due to the expense of operating the equipment.  Fortunately our BCM programed itself avoiding the $250 fee.  Thank you Christian Brothers for being honest and holding yourselves to a higher standard.  Any other automotive shop would have charges us the $250 fee regardless if they programed the BCM or not. Christian Bothers also works with a local church to help single mothers with car issues.  Great owner that cares about the people in his community.  Keep up the great work!  You've got my business.

We asked for both my headlight bulbs to be replaced and to correct for a strange noise we couldn't identify. When we dropped the car off in the morning, we asked them if they wanted to listen to the noise together so we could figure out the problem together. They refused to spend the time diagnosing the problem with us. They said they would take care of it and call us. So we left.
After calling twice throughout the day for an update, they couldn't give us one for the noise, nor did they call back. We asked twice to be called back and didn't get one.
When we came back at the end of the day about an hour before they were to close, they had only just started the work. They said the belt was the issue and needed to be replaced. We gave assent to replace the belt.
However, after the belt was replaced we immediately noticed that this did NOT take care of the original issue of the noise we wanted taken care of when inspecting the vehicle. It turns out it was a power steering problem.
So it's possible the belt may have needed replacing, but that's not what we came in for to fix. If they had taken the time and called us back to discuss the noises it might not have been a problem. But they didn't
When confronted, they offered to not charge anything at all, but that was only after some arguement. They were embarrassed in our opinion. Their arguments didn't hold much weight both of us knew in my opinion. Their only argument was that we didn't describe the noise properly....however describing sounds is obviously a subjective thing. That's why it was important they take the time to diagnose it together we said, but they wouldn't. However, we said we would pay for the lightbulb replacement because that was correct still, but wouldn't pay for the belt replacement since it wasn't what we came in for.
This was our 3rd experience at this place. Each time there was a problem during or after. We won't be going back.
Overall I have to say that they are Fair to customers....but they charge too much for bad work.

"My name is Jeff Toth, I'm the owner of Christian Brothers Automotive, The Woodlands. I have researched this report and have found that this is from a repair preformed in October 2003. At that time I was not the owner of this location but have pulled all documents pertaining to the repair. I must admit I am surprised that this complaint is just now coming to light, after almost 6 years. Our records indicate that our customers clutch was replaced and that there was one return visit almost 3 months later for a "shudder" feeling. At that time it was determined that there was a "knock" in the motor and that there was internal engine damage usually caused by not properly maintaining a vehicle that would require the repair or replacement of the engine. There was not a "shudder" detected after testing the vehicle, the issue was related to the engine knock not the transmission.
